Caroline Bond completed her BA in Art and Design Education in the National College of Art and Design in 1982. Her love and commitment to education brought her to work in Pobalscoil Neasáin, Baldoyle, where she has taught Art, Craft and Design Education for the past 32 years.

Through teaching Caroline has had the opportunity to explore, experiment and develop experience and skills in many diverse media. Several media became important to her personal visual expression: Iconography, Ceramics, Printmaking, and Painting. Returning to Continuing Education in NCAD, Caroline became increasingly fascinated with working in wax and casting in Bronze through the Lost Wax process. She studied under Vivian Hansbury for 5 years.

Caroline’s new series of cast bronze sculptures are called  “War Horses”, the horses echo the emotional  position of the many people who find themselves caught up in the line of fire between conflict and war.
